Overview TELMITRAX-H 40MG/12.5MG TABLET
Each TELMITRAX-H 40MG/12.5MG tablet combines two blood pressure-regulating medications, typically prescribed when a single agent proves insufficient. This dual action reduces the risk of future heart attacks and strokes by effectively managing hypertension. TELMITRAX-H 40MG/12.5MG can be taken with or without food, dosage adjusted to individual response and health status. Consistent daily timing is recommended. Continue treatment as directed by your physician; discontinuation increases stroke and heart attack risk. The formulation includes a diuretic, promoting increased urination, so avoid doses within four hours of bedtime. Regular use, even with symptom improvement, is crucial for optimal benefit. Dizziness is the most common side effect, others including fatigue, nausea, dyspnea, and palpitations. Increased urination is expected; it's a therapeutic mechanism, not an adverse reaction. While rare, other side effects are possible. Consult the included patient information leaflet, and report persistent or bothersome effects to your doctor; dosage adjustment or alternative medication may be considered. Avoid potassium supplements and salt substitutes unless explicitly advised by your physician. This medication is contraindicated during pregnancy and lactation. Consult your doctor before use if you have kidney or liver impairment, cardiac issues, or diabetes. Alcohol consumption may exacerbate blood pressure lowering and side effects.

S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Alcohol consumption alongside TELMITRAX-H 40MG/12.5MG TABLETS lacks established safety data. Seek medical advice before combining them.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Using TELMITRAX-H 40MG/12.5MG tablets during pregnancy poses a confirmed risk to the fetus. Therefore, its use is inadvisable. In exceptional, life-threatening circumstances, a physician might prescribe it if the potential benefits outweigh the known hazards. Always seek medical advice.
Breast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
The use of TELMITRAX-H 40MG/12.5MG TABLETS while breastfeeding is likely inadvisable. Available evidence from humans indicates potential transfer to breast milk, posing a possible risk to the infant.
DrivingUNSAFE
Taking TELMITRAX-H 40MG/12.5MG TABLETS might cause drowsiness, blurred vision, or dizziness. Refrain from driving if you experience these effects.
KidneyCAUTION
Patients with severe kidney impairment should use TELMITRAX-H 40MG/12.5MG TABLETS c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Physician consultation is advised. TELMITRAX-H 40MG/12.5MG TABLETS are contraindicated in patients with severe renal disease.
LiverCAUTION
Patients with liver impairment should use TELMITRAX-H 40MG/12.5MG TABLETS cautiously, as d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.
What if you forget to take TELMITRAX-H 40MG/12.5MG TABLET :
Should you forget to take your TELMITRAX-H 40MG/12.5MG TABLET, administer it immediately upon remembering.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
